I'll list the EPCOT restaurants in the order of my liking. I'll make brief notes why I like each one.

LeCellier - Each experience there has been wonderful. Sometimes I just need a good piece of meat.
Chef De France - Wonderful ambiance and great food. A festive place.
San Angel Inn - I love the feeling of this restaurant more than the food. However, I had the ribeye tacos the last time and they were fantastic! Great chips and salsa.
Nine Dragons - I live close to Philadelphia and New York, so I get really good Chinese food on a regular basis, so the novelty of this restaurant was lost on me. Food is very good.
Teppan Edo - A fun, tasty time. One's experience can vary based on the chef at your table/grill.
Tokyo Diner - No opinion - never been there.
